14. To separate the yolks from the whites, use a plastic water bottle.

Cost: $1–$2* Goal: Easily separate yolks and whites Since this life hack has been making the rounds on the Internet for a while, we're just making sure you know about it in case you were unaware. All you need for this hack is a 20-ounce empty water bottle ($1-2) to separate the yolks and whites.

Separate the yolks from the whites using a plastic water bottle (@wonderhowto/Pinterest). Crack the egg and place it on a dish. Squeeze the bottle and hold it upside-down, pressing the mouth onto the egg yolk. Release the bottle's pressure gradually. Due to its distinct density, the yolk will be drawn into the container independently of the whites.
